Regarding interest rate risk -- there should be practically none. Rising rates do squeeze bank profits, but should not affect the numbers of bills people pay, the number of checks they write, or the economies of scale that Checkfree offers.

I've noticed no effect on the stock from Fed rumors or Fed decisions, and seen no discussion of any here or in the Motley Fool thread.
